TURN-208: Gatevale turnstile counters at the Merrow Field pilot double-count when a rotation reverses mid-cycle. Attendance totals drift roughly 2% high per event. The debounce window fix is implemented, reviewed by Ilsa, and soak-tested across two simulated match days without drift. Ready for your cut; the candidate build is identified below.

trace token, tagag-tafog: htk6_5ed18c

## Runbook: Dependency Pinning (Brindlewick Services)

Quick refresher for the security review: everything in the Brindlewick monorepo pins exact versions, no ranges, no floating tags. Renovations happen through the weekly bump job, which opens one PR per service so audits stay readable. Anything pulled outside the job needs a signed-off exception. The pinning enforcement settings currently applied to the build agents are shown below.

deployment values, fahap-hahaf:
[casdor]
port = 9200
region = south-2
host = casdor.qirvanworks.corp
timeout_ms = 3000
retries = 4

Recovery Runbook — Tintshade Audit Console

If a reviewer is locked out of the Tintshade color-contrast audit dashboard, do not reset the account; that wipes pending WCAG annotations. Use the recovery flow from the admin sidebar instead. The flow asks for the shared reviewer recovery passphrase before restoring access. Enter the passphrase shown below exactly, including spacing.

unlock words, hahap-yawig: pelix-kelion-tamys-jorix-julok

The Validata platform loads validator plugins at startup from the registered manifest and runs each in declaration order. As a contractor, you should register your plugin in the staging registry first and confirm it passes the conformance suite before requesting promotion. Registry calls are authenticated with a service credential scoped to plugin uploads only; never reuse it elsewhere. The staging registry key is provided below.

gateway credential: kto23_LX9A4ys6i4nzHtpOLNLodKK